Dear list,
I am a bit confused on the use of add_custom_target, I hope someone can 
help me.

Here is what I am trying to do:
I have a number of subdirectories that build libraries, and then I build 
the final executable with a custom command (I am wrapping all the 
libraries in a tclkit executable). Some libraries consist of c++ code, 
others of just tcl code (I just need to copy the tcl files at 
compilation time).

Here is how I tried to do it:
- In case of c++ libraries I use add_library,
- in case of pure tcl libraries I use add_custom_command and 
add_custom_target to copy the files (I do not use configure_file because 
I want to copy the files at build time and not configuration time).
- In the main CMakeLists.txt I use add_custom_command and 
add_custom_target to wrap the libraries into an tclkit executable.

Here is the problem:
when I use DEPENDS in the main add_custom_command, it finds the targets 
generated by add_library, but it complains about the ones generated by 
add_custom_target with a "No rule to make target" even though the 
targets are built ("[ 82%] Built target targetB")

Here is a simplified example (in case the above didn't make too much sense):

main_dir/CMakeLists.txt: --------------------
PROJECT(main)
subdirs(dirA dirB)
ADD_CUSTOM_COMMAND(
   OUTPUT ${EXECUTABLE_OUTPUT_PATH}/main_custom${CMAKE_EXECUTABLE_SUFFIX}
   COMMAND wrap_libs_to_tclkit_exe
   DEPENDS targetA targetB
)
ADD_CUSTOM_TARGET(main_custom ALL
   DEPENDS ${EXECUTABLE_OUTPUT_PATH}/main_custom${CMAKE_EXECUTABLE_SUFFIX}
)

main_dir/dirA/CMakeLists.txt: -----------------
PROJECT(targetA)
ADD_LIBRARY(${PROJECT_NAME} SHARED file1.cxx file2.cxx file3.cxx)
TARGET_LINK_LIBRARIES(${PROJECT_NAME} blabla)

main_dir/dirB/CMakeLists.txt: -----------------
PROJECT(targetB)
SET(TCL_FILES file1.tcl file2.tcl file3.tcl)
ADD_CUSTOM_TARGET(${PROJECT_NAME} ALL)
FOREACH(file ${TCL_FILES})
   GET_FILENAME_COMPONENT(name ${file} NAME)
   SET(tgt ${LIBRARY_OUTPUT_PATH}/${name})
   SET(src ${file})
   ADD_CUSTOM_COMMAND(
     TARGET ${PROJECT_NAME}
     COMMAND ${CMAKE_COMMAND}
     ARGS -E copy_if_different ${src} ${tgt}
     DEPENDS ${src}
     COMMENT "copying file: ${src} ${tgt}"
     )
ENDFOREACH(file)

The result is that both targetA and targetB are built, but when building 
main_custom I get the "No rule to make target `targetB'" problem. I 
don't get any error with only targets on the same type as targetA.

What am I doing wrong?
